Low Contact Force (LCF) gas springs are designed to reduce excessive shock loads, high noise levels and extreme pad bounce, all factors that lead to high press maintenance costs and noise pollution.
Key Advantages:
1. Shock Load Reduction: Reduce shock loads by up to 50%, safeguarding drive components and gears to minimize maintenance needs.
2. Noise Reduction: Experience quieter operations compared to standard gas springs, for a safer working environment.
3. Pad/ Blank-Holder Bounce Reduction: Minimize pad/ blank-holder bounce for smoother part-transfer efficiency, resulting in enhanced production rates and minimized scrap.

Features:
• 100% compatibility with standard ISO gas springs (e.g., TU Series).
• Seamless retrofit into existing dies.
• Charged and rebuilt with ease, just like standard gas springs.
• Versatile mounting options: choose from drop-in, flange mount, or base plate mounting.
• Ability to be hosed together.

By mounting directly to the die and remaining independent from the press, the advantages of LCF gas springs seamlessly accompany the tool, ensuring efficiency and productivity enhancements throughout your operations.

L minMinimum Length (in)5.24
SStroke Length (in)1.5
LTotal Length (in)6.74

Item specifications

  • End Force At Full Stroke (LBF)2700
  • Force Increase By Temperature Percent Per (°F)0.17
  • Gas Volume (CuF)0.00211888
  • Initial Force at max. pressure (lbf) 1665
  • Max Charging Pressure (Psi)2175
  • Max Piston Rod Velocity (FtMin)314.96
  • Max. Operating Temperature (F)176
  • Min Charging Pressure (PSI)1015
  • Min. Operating Temperature (F)32
  • Recommended Max Strokes Per Minute~15-40
  • Weight (lb)3.3
